Output a62561c18738ed10ea15d27b45f3a06892820da3c830c7c8375bfb05cb09fc0f:15

value
278834890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a28441ac80fe86b161fe96661fd1f46516a6c9 OP_EQUAL
address
3BxaHt7CsGtXVt18zf3h3fSht3uxrNqiFU
transaction
a62561c18738ed10ea15d27b45f3a06892820da3c830c7c8375bfb05cb09fc0f
spent
true